> After learning to use cdrecord to burn data CDs
> (see previous messages of the present thread),
> now I want to burn audio CDs. But, when I insert
> the audio CD in the driver, Linux doesn't see it.
> In fact, if I do: '$ ls /mnt/cdrom' I get no output.
> I also tried with: '# mount /mnt/cdrom' but got the
> following output:
> 
>       /dev/hdc: Input/output error
>       mount: /dev/hdc: can't read superblock
> 
> . Any help?
> 
> Thanks,
> Rodolfo
> 
> 
You can not mount audio CDs. They do not have a file system on them. But
you can play them with any of the CD player programs.
